Why Oak Brook Requires Specialized Property Management

Oak Brook is one of the most prominent corporate and retail submarkets in the Chicago metropolitan area. Known for its concentration of headquarters buildings and destination retail, Oak Brook operates at an institutional level compared to most suburban markets.

The local commercial real estate inventory includes:

  • Class A corporate office campuses
  • High-end multi-tenant office buildings
  • Regional and destination retail centers
  • Mixed-use commercial developments
  • Professional and medical office space

With direct access to Interstate 88, Interstate 294, and Interstate 290, Oak Brook serves as a strategic hub for corporate users and regional retail demand.

Managing property in Oak Brook requires familiarity with:

  • Institutional CAM structures across large assets
  • Corporate tenant expectations and service levels
  • Large parking field management and snow logistics
  • Roof and mechanical system lifecycle planning
  • Vendor coordination for high-traffic retail environments
  • Municipal permitting and inspection processes

Operational precision is critical in this market, where tenants expect consistent performance and ownership demands institutional-level reporting.

The Hidden Inefficiency in Most Property Management

Many property management firms focus primarily on maintenance response. While maintenance matters, the real difference between average and disciplined management appears in the back office.

  • Invoices arrive daily
  • Leases define different CAM structures
  • Expenses must be allocated precisely

When these processes rely on manual spreadsheets and email threads, small inconsistencies accumulate:

  • Repairs are miscoded
  • Expenses are under-allocated
  • Documentation is incomplete

Individually minor. Collectively expensive.

  • Revenue leakage becomes routine
  • CAM recoveries lose precision
  • Managers spend time reconciling paperwork rather than improving asset performance

In institutional markets like Oak Brook, even small inefficiencies directly reduce NOI and asset value.

Lease Complexity Requires Structure

Every commercial lease defines responsibility differently.

  • HVAC maintenance
  • Roof repairs
  • Utilities
  • Snow removal
  • Capital expenditures

Large office and retail assets in Oak Brook often include additional complexity:

  • Multi-tenant CAM allocation structures
  • Utility submetering and cost recovery
  • Retail lease structures and percentage rent
  • Tenant improvement amortization
  • Corporate lease compliance requirements

Without disciplined systems, property managers rely on informal processes to track responsibilities. This increases the risk of under-recovery and tenant disputes.

Structured lease abstraction and documented allocation standards ensure lease provisions are enforced consistently while protecting ownership revenue.
